Hamlet (Mandarin)

"To be or not to be, that is the question." For more than 400 years, Hamlet, arguably William Shakespeare's greatest tragedy, has enthralled countless dramatists and scholars. The play tells the tale of how Hamlet, prince of Denmark, avenged his dead father, in an allegory for English and European history.

Beijing Comedy Theater is putting on a Mandarin version of the play through this weekend.

Learn more here

If you go:
7:30 pm, March 2-10 (except March 5 and 6). Beijing Comedy Theater, 11 Chaoyangmen North Street, Dongcheng district, Beijing. 400-610-3721.
Ticket: 80-500 yuan (half price for a second ticket)
